[jira] [Created] (TINKERPOP-1510) Inline comments in Gremlin console

Daniel Kuppitz created TINKERPOP-1510:
-----------------------------------------

             Summary: Inline comments in Gremlin console
                 Key: TINKERPOP-1510
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/TINKERPOP-1510
             Project: TinkerPop
          Issue Type: Bug
          Components: console
    Affects Versions: 3.2.2
            Reporter: Daniel Kuppitz


A while back it was no issue to have inline comments in multi-line Gremlin traversals; code samples from the docs could easily be copied and pasted. Now I just tried to paste a code block and ended up with this:

{noformat}
gremlin> g.V(input.head()).
......1>            repeat(out('hasParent')).emit().as('x'). //(1)
groovysh_parse: 3: unexpected token: . @ line 3, column 51.
   t('hasParent')).emit().as('x'). //(1)
{noformat}
